# DragonFlagon Active Lights ![Forge Installs](https://img.shields.io/badge/dynamic/json?color=red&label=Forge%20Installs&query=package.installs&suffix=%25&url=https%3A%2F%2Fforge-vtt.com%2Fapi%2Fbazaar%2Fpackage%2Fdf-active-lights) ![Latest Version](https://img.shields.io/badge/dynamic/json?label=Latest%20Release&prefix=v&query=package.versions%5B0%5D&url=https%3A%2F%2Fforge-vtt.com%2Fapi%2Fbazaar%2Fpackage%2Fdf-active-lights) [![Foundry Hub Endorsements](https://img.shields.io/endpoint?logoColor=white&url=https%3A%2F%2Fwww.foundryvtt-hub.com%2Fwp-json%2Fhubapi%2Fv1%2Fpackage%2Fdf-active-lights%2Fshield%2Fendorsements)](https://www.foundryvtt-hub.com/package/df-active-lights/) This module provides a way to animate all the various configurations of a light. This animation will be synchronized with the server so that all players should see the same animation states. A simple example for this would be for creating a simple Light House where the light's direction would animate all the way around a 180° rotation. The configuration window for Active Lights can be opened from the Light Animation tab in any Ambient Light config window. ![Light House](../.assets/df-active-lights/df-active-lights.gif) ![Energy Dome](../.assets/df-active-lights/df-active-lights2.gif) ![Laser Light](../.assets/df-active-lights/df-active-lights3.gif) ![Police Car](../.assets/df-active-lights/df-active-lights4.gif) ## Animation Functions The way animations work is that at time T, the position along the transition is at a deterministic position along a mathematical curve. This is some really fancy talk for basically making a dot follow a line.
